一种边缘自适应的去隔行插值方法技术

技术编号:3585595 阅读:230 留言:0更新日期:2012-04-11 18:40
本发明专利技术公开了一种边缘自适应的去隔行插值方法,该方法针对传统ELA插值方法存在的问题提出了改进,通过采用边缘自适应技术,利用两行的相关性插值出两行中间缺失行的信息,其特征在于:通过对多个方向分别进行检测,将相关性最强的方向选为插值方向,每个方向又选取多组数据进行联合判断以提高判断的准确性,该方法是一种低成本,易于硬件实现,并且具有良好的边缘保护和去边缘锯齿能力的去隔行插值算法,能够自适应的调整插值方向,对任意方向都能做出良好的插值结果,该方法不但对二维插值有效,同样也适用于三维插值。

【技术实现步骤摘要】

本专利技术涉及一种对数字图像信号进行去隔行处理时提高图像分辨率的方 法,具体来说,尤其涉及
技术介绍
传统的模拟电视图像为隔行的形式,每一个图像帧被分割成两个场,每一 个场都只扫描预定的水平行数。在每一个场周期内,只扫描帧中的一半水平行, 两场按顺序连续显示,让扫描看起来是逐行的,使观众感知到整个图像。这种 方法的最大弊端是会带来垂直分辨率的降低,因为每一场只包含了完整帧中一 半的垂直信息。随着数字图像技术的发展,高清晰的数字电视越来越多的出现 在人们生活中,它们采用逐行扫描方式。因此,将隔行的电视信号输入逐行的电视显示系统时,要进行去隔行(De-interlace)。去隔行技术有三维和二维的两 种大类型,传统二维技术对整场均采用空域插值,这种办法不区分图像静止与 运动,因此往往对静止图像的再现力不够,三维技术对运动物体采用空域插值, 而对静止物体采用时域平均(替换)的策略。可见无论哪种去隔行技术,都会 应用到图像插值,一种好的去隔行插值算法是一个好的去隔行技术/设备的基础。 传统的图像插值算法有双线性和双立方算法。双线性算法往往使插值的图 像边缘变模糊,而双立方算法则会使图像边缘出现锯齿。研究表明,人眼对物 体清晰度的感知主要来源于物体的边界信息,因此近年来出现了一些新的基于 边缘的插值方法,这些算法对插值后的图像清晰度有显著的提高。比如基于边缘插值法,,(EDDI),基于数据的三角插值法(DDT),还有基于边界的 线平均法(ELA)等等。由于去隔行插值是一种在垂直方向上1: 2放大的简 单插值,而DDT和EDDI计算量庞大,不是很适合用来做去隔行插值。相对来 说,ELA是一种很好的去隔行插值方法。这种算法依据图像的边缘进行插值, 计算量相当小,适于硬件实现。同时只用到了两个行缓存,比双立方插值所用 的缓存还小,而性能却比双立方和双线形好很多,在很多时候,甚至不亚于EDDI 和DDT的插值效果。图1给出了现有一个ELA插值算法的示意图。如图所示, a e5个方向被分别检测,最后插值的输出结果^(/,/)为f/,(/,_/)=|f/(/-i,/—/j+^(/+i,./h) (1) 其中函数f代表图像得亮度信息。i^表示待插点亮度,f,代表已知点亮度。由以下关系式来决定。=argmi,) -2《d《2 (2)这里,4^T《是一个集合,^/#(力=|《(/-力-+ -2《d《2 (3)min()代表求集合4^《中的最小值,arg()代表求集合W浙《中令^/#幼值最 小的d的值,例如,min(J浙^hc/劝^,则arg(min(c/^问XH。但是ELA本身也存在一些弱点,比如,很容易产生插值错误,这是因为随 着被检测像素与中心点距离的增加,像素对之间的差异往往会变小,以上简单 的对5个方向进行差异性比较,就很容易在错误的方向上进行插值。另外,由 于只对5个方向进行检测,所以无法对任意方向的边缘都得到好的插值效果。 因此,有必要对传统的ELA算法做出改进,使其更稳定,插值效果更好。
技术实现思路
本专利技术针对上述传统ela插值方法存在的问题提出了改进,公开了,该方法通过采用边缘自适应技术,利用两行的相 关性插值出两行中间缺失行的信息,其特征在于通过对多个方向分别进行检 测,将相关性最强的方向选为插值方向,每个方向又选取多组数据进行联合判 断以提高判断的准确性,该方法具体包括如下步骤-步骤l:选择待插点F (i,j)的主方向群和从方向群以及与它们各自相关的 像素对;步骤2:比较每个方向所属像素对亮度的差值的绝对值,将差值绝对值最小的方向作为最后的插值方向;步骤3:通过调整偏移量修改从方向群以确定下一待插点的从方向,偏移量 由步长控制调整;步骤4:依据步骤2中确定的插值方向进行插值; 所述方法中步骤3和步骤4的顺序可以交换。上述步骤(1)中所述的主方向群的方向是固定的,所述的待插点F(i, j)的主方向群包含有以下三个主方向主西北方向连接点(i-l,j-l)和点(i+l,j+l)的直线,用-l作为方向代号;主北方向连接点(i-l,j)和点(i+l,j)的直线,用0作为方向代号;主东北方向连接点(i-l,j+l)和点(i+l,j-l)的直线,用1作为方向代号;与所有三个主方向相关的像素对可概括为下式<formula>complex formula see original document page 7</formula> (4)其中,m和mt/的取值为整数。 上述步骤(l)中所述的从方向群由偏移量q^d决定,q侨W是一个变化量, 并由步长控制每次的增减量,对于待插点F (i, j)和特定的偏移量q^&,不妨 假设q侨向右为正,向左为负,三个从方向为从西北方向连接点(i-l,j-l+o,eO和点(i+l,J+l-o,)的直线,用-1作为方向 代号;从北方向连接点(i-l,j+o^&)和点(i+l,j-q诉d)的直线,用0作为方向代号;从东北方向连接点(i-l,j+l+o,)和点(i+l,j-l-o^^)的直线,用1作为方向 代号;与所有三个从方向相关的像素对可以概括为<formula>complex formula see original document page 8</formula> (5)其中,偏移量初始值为0, m取值为整数。本专利技术,所述步骤(2)中还包括如下的 具体步骤步骤2.1:通过以下公式计算出主方向群中各个方向像素对亮度的差值的绝 对值<formula>complex formula see original document page 8</formula>(6)其中,《f 6m/J表示主方向像素对的差值的绝对值,md表示主方向代号;步骤2.2:计算出从方向群中各个方向像素对亮度的差值的绝对值 <formula>complex formula see original document page 8</formula> (7)其中,#6^代表从方向像素对的差值的绝对值,^为从方向代号,伊/w为补偿增益,它是一个浮点数,其值由从北方向偏移主北方向的距离来决定,具体为当从北方向偏移主北方向的距离增加,补偿增益值增大,反之减小。g&的最小值大于l,最大值不超过5。步骤2.3:从上述主/从两个方向群中选出像素对亮度差值的绝对值最小的方向为最后的插值方向。所述方法步骤(3)中还包括如下的具体步骤步骤3.1:对步长赋值,其值等于像素对亮度差值的绝对值最小的方向的代 号,该代号用0, 1或一l中任意一个数字表示;步骤3.2:判断所选的方向是否为主方向,如果是,复位信号置l,否则置0;步骤3.3:调整偏移量,若复位信号为l,偏移量直接由步长替换,否则,步 长累加到偏移量后作为新的偏移量。所述方法步骤(4)中还进一步包括以下步骤通过以下公式计算插值<formula>complex formula see original document page 9</formula>其中函数F代表图像的亮度值。F/P表示待插点亮度值,F/代表已知点亮度值。 (/-1,本文档来自技高网
...

【技术保护点】
一种边缘自适应的去隔行插值方法,该方法通过采用边缘自适应技术,利用两行的相关性插值出两行中间缺失行的信息,其特征在于:通过对多个方向分别进行检测,将相关性最强的方向选为插值方向,每个方向又选取多组数据进行联合判断以提高判断的准确性,该方法具体包括如下步骤:步骤1:选择待插点F(i,j)的主方向群和从方向群以及与它们各自相关的像素对;步骤2:比较每个方向所属像素对亮度的差值的绝对值,将差值绝对值最小的方向作为最后的插值方向;步骤3:通过调整偏移量修改从方向群以确定下一待插点的从方向,偏移量由步长控制调整;步骤4:依据步骤2中确定的插值方向进行插值;所述方法中步骤3和步骤4的顺序可以交换。

【技术特征摘要】
1、一种边缘自适应的去隔行插值方法,该方法通过采用边缘自适应技术,利用两行的相关性插值出两行中间缺失行的信息,其特征在于通过对多个方向分别进行检测,将相关性最强的方向选为插值方向,每个方向又选取多组数据进行联合判断以提高判断的准确性,该方法具体包括如下步骤步骤1选择待插点F(i,j)的主方向群和从方向群以及与它们各自相关的像素对;步骤2比较每个方向所属像素对亮度的差值的绝对值,将差值绝对值最小的方向作为最后的插值方向;步骤3通过调整偏移量修改从方向群以确定下一待插点的从方向,偏移量由步长控制调整;步骤4依据步骤2中确定的插值方向进行插值;所述方法中步骤3和步骤4的顺序可以交换。2、 根据权利要求1所述的一种边缘自适应的去隔行插值方法,其特征在于该方法步骤(1)中所述的主方向群是固定的,所述的待插点F(i, j)包含有以下三个主方向主西北方向连接点(i-lj-l)和点(i+l,j+l)的直线,用-l作为方向代号;主北方向连接点(i-l,j)和点(i+l,j)的直线,用0作为方向代号;主东北方向连接点(i-l,j+l)和点(i+l,j-l)的直线,用1作为方向代号;与所有三个主方向相关的像素对可概括为<formula>complex formula see original document page 2</formula> (1)其中,w和md的取值为整数。3、 根据权利要求1所述的一种边缘自适应的去隔行插值方法,其特征在于 该方法步骤(1)中所述的从方向群的方向是由偏移量offset决定,offset是一个变化量,并由步长控制每次的增减量,对于待插点F(i,j)和特定的偏移量oi^ ,不妨假设0# 向右为正,向左为负,三个从方向为从西北方向连接点(i-l,j-l+q^W)和点(i+l,j+l-0,ef)的直线,用-1作为方向代号;从北方向连接点(i-l,j+q^&)和点(i+l,j-o/^0的直线,用0作为方向代号; 从东北方向连接点(i-l,j+l+q^W)和点(i+lJ-l-o,&)的直线,用1作为方向 代号;与所有三个从方向相关的像素对可以概括为U ((/-1,+附),0' ++ w)) (-1+ 《(l+ (2)其中,偏移量的初始值为O, m取值为整数。4、根据权利要求l所述的一种边缘自适应的去隔行...

【专利技术属性】
技术研发人员:李琛常军锋刘波石岭刘云
申请(专利权)人:深圳艾科创新微电子有限公司
类型:发明
国别省市:94[中国|深圳]

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1